1984, Hill Mountain developed The King's Secret Envoy, which was published by IBM to show the powerful computing power of IBM PC. This game is quite successful and has become one of the most popular games developed by Shere Mountain, and there are many patterns derived from this game.
Since 1990, Shereshan has started to cooperate with other companies, such as Dynamix, Bright Star Tech, Coktel Vision and Impression Games. Later partners included Green Thumb Software Company, arion Software Company, Papyrus Design Group, Berkeley Systems Company, Work Book Company, PyroTechnix Company and Headgate Company. 1994, Xue Leshan was sold to "CUC International" in its entirety. Ken left Hill Hill a year later. 1997 65438+In February, CUC and HFS merged into Shengteng Software Company. 1998, Xie Leshan was transferred to French publishing company Hawass again, and Vivendi was the giant behind this company.
In the same year, Xue Leshan was divided into five parts:
1. The attraction of Hill Mountain-publishing games such as Huo Yier and You Don't Know Jack.
2.shere Mountain House- Publishing family-oriented software, such as "painting experts".
3. xueleshan sports-publishing sports games developed by papyrus design group.
4. Learn from Leshan Studio-release large-scale games, such as "The Secret Envoy of the King" and other games developed by Leshan itself.
5. Dynamix of Xie Leshan Company.
The company located in the original site was renamed "Yosemite Entertainment" on 1998.
1February 22, 999, the headquarters of Xue Leshan decided to close most of its development studios, and Yosemite was no exception. This day was later called "Black Monday" by Hill Hill supporters. This decision also means the reorganization of Shereshan Company. 135 employees were fired because of this change.
Another big reorganization also took place in 1999, and this time "Learning Leshan Studio" and "Learning Leshan Sports" were closed. More than 105 employees were fired. Since then, Xue Leshan no longer mainly produces games, but publishes them.
In 2002, the company was renamed "Learning Leshan Entertainment".
In June 2004, Vivendi reorganized its own game department and dissolved Shereshan Company in August. Snow Mountain exists in name only.
